ALAMEDA – Checking in with observations from the portion of practice open to the media.
*Josh McCown limped out to practice around 11:30 a.m., as the team was in the middle of special teams work. He’s wearing a walking boot on his left foot and walking gingerly on his right foot.
If he’s walking like that today, I can’t see how he plays on Sunday. Two days of no practice should mean Daunte Culpepper starts in Miami.
But will Lane Kiffin admit that. We'll have to wait and see.
*Derrick Burgess (calf) was chatting with Al Davis near the entrance to the team locker room, but wasn’t practicing. The Pro Bowl defensive end has been out since the fourth quarter of the Raiders’ Week 2 loss at Denver.
*Reserve linebacker and special teams standout Robert Thomas (hamstring) was back at practice.
